### Audit-log viewer (Vantacle)

Read-only access to Vantacle is granted automatically with the reviewer role. Logs are immutable; exports are watermarked per session. Filters cover actor, resource, and time range — free-text search is intentionally disabled. Retention is 400 days. Do not screenshot entries containing subject data; use the redacted export instead. Access policy, field definitions, and the export procedure are documented on the internal page:

runbook for tajep-yahig: https://artifactory.lumictech.corp/repo

## Partitioning Capacity Note

The Drayton ledger tables are partitioned by month. Each partition holds roughly one billion rows at current ingest, and we pre-create three months ahead via the scheduler. Do not create partitions by hand; the tooling owns naming and retention. Old partitions detach after the retention horizon and archive to cold storage. If ingest grows past plan, bump the pre-create count first, not partition granularity. Current tooling defaults are as follows.

constants for bawep-fajog:
RATE_LIMITS = {
    "oliath": 2,
    "wenix": 5,
    "quenael": 5,
    "ralix": 2,
}

## Authentication

Hey plugin folks! Before your plugin can talk to the LadleLogic scaling engine, you'll need to authenticate against our internal PortionProxy service. Every request to the scaling endpoints must include a key in the `X-Ladle-Key` header, or you'll get a 401 and a mildly sarcastic error message. Keys are per-plugin, so don't share yours around. For local testing against the sandbox, use the key below.

gateway credential: kto3_qfe

Q: How do I let drivers through the shuttle-bus gate at Kestrel Point? A: The gate near Dock B stays locked outside peak hours, so facilities desk staff will need to open it manually for any off-schedule shuttle. Check the driver's roster entry first, then use the gate code below.

staff pass of kawep-hahap = bdg-IEUUF-6